General thought is that they couldn't really stop them if they wanted to given that most third party companies are centered in China, which is a bit lax in terms of enforcing intellectual ownership laws. Another thought is that the third party stuff doesn't really overlap with much of what Hasbro does anyway (and in most cases, supplements it), and that the fans that buy this stuff pretty well buy all the official stuff anyway. So Hasbro doesn't really have all that much to gain from trying to stop it other than a giant legal headache with the same nation that makes their stuff too.

More or less this. Sure, they could bring the hammer down on third-party stuff, if not shutting them down entirely then at least making it much more difficult for them to manufacture and sell their product (possibly to the point where it would be unprofitable). But why in the world would they want to? It would cost millions of dollars and piss off a good chunk of their fanbase, vendors and manufacturers. And for all that trouble, Hasbro wouldn't actually gain anything but a moral victory.Clay wrote:So Hasbro doesn't really have all that much to gain from trying to stop it other than a giant legal headache with the same nation that makes their stuff too.
That said, I wouldn't be surprised if their own ex-employees doing it would warrant a somewhat less lackadaisical response...
